Ingredients
Scale
- 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 1 cup cottage cheese
- 1 cup marinara sauce
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h basil for garnish (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Season the chicken breasts with sal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ning.
- In a skillet over medium heat, cook the chicken for 6-7 minutes on each side, until it’s cooked thoroughly and re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C).
- In a bowl, mix the cottage cheese and half of the marinara sauce.
- Once the chicken is cooked, place it in a baking dish. Spread the cottage cheese mixture over the chicken, then pour the remaining marinara sauce on top.
- Sprinkle the mozzarella cheese evenly over the chicken.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
- Remove from the oven and let it cool for a few minutes. Garnish with fresh basil if desired before serving.
Notes
To enhance the flavor, let the chicken marinade in Italian seasoning for a few hours if you have time. You can add vegetables like spinach or bell peppers into the marinara sauce for added nutrients and flavor. Use low-fat cottage cheese for a lighter version of the dish.
